What are Hyper Casual Games?

Hyper casual games are characterized by minimalistic gameplay and straightforward mechanics. Their target audience ranges from casual gamers to experienced players, allowing them to be easily accessible. The primary appeal lies in their instant gratification, allowing users to pick up a game and play it for a few minutes without a steep learning curve.

Key Features of Hyper Casual Games

  • Simple Controls: Most hyper casual games utilize one-tap controls making them easy to learn.
  • Quick Sessions: Players can enjoy quick gameplay sessions that are perfect for on-the-go gaming.
  • Instant Feedback: Immediate rewards keep players engaged and motivated.
  • Viral Potential: Their engaging yet straightforward design fosters shareability among friends.

Why Build Hyper Casual Games?

Developing hyper casual games offers unique opportunities for game developers. The low barrier to entry allows smaller teams to create and launch games quickly, testing concepts in the market rapidly. Moreover, these games often have high retention rates, increasing revenue for developers.

The Process of Building Hyper Casual Games

Building a hyper casual game involves several stages:

  1. Concept Development: Brainstorming unique game ideas that can quickly engage players.
  2. Prototyping: Creating a simple prototype to test gameplay mechanics.
  3. User Testing: Collecting feedback from potential players to refine the game.
  4. Launch: Releasing the game to app stores and marketing it to reach a wider audience.

Examples of Popular Hyper Casual Games

Some stellar examples of hyper casual games include:

Game Title Developer Launch Year
Helix Jump Voodoo 2018
Flappy Bird Dong Nguyen 2013
Paper.io Voodoo 2016

The Role of Advertising in Hyper Casual Games

Many hyper casual games utilize ad-based monetization strategies. It includes displaying ads during gameplay or offering rewards for watching ads. This approach not only generates revenue but also keeps the games free for users, which is a significant factor in their popularity.

Hyper Casual Games vs. Traditional Games

When comparing hyper casual games to traditional gaming experiences, significant differences emerge:

  • Complexity: Traditional games often involve elaborate storylines and complex controls, while hyper casual games thrive on simplicity.
  • Time Investment: Traditional games can require long sessions, whereas hyper casual games cater to short bursts of playtime.
  • Cost: Hyper casual games are mostly free-to-play, while traditional games typically involve upfront costs.

Challenges in Building Hyper Casual Games

While building hyper casual games seems straightforward, developers often face challenges, such as:

  • Cutting through market noise amidst a flood of similar games.
  • Innovating gameplay while maintaining simplicity.
  • Finding sustainable monetization strategies in a free model.
